Effect of the chain length on nearKeywords: Near-infrared spectroscopy,alcohols,spectra-structure correlations,chain length effect Abstract: This work shows the effect of the chain length on near-infrared spectra of 1-alcohols and is based on a recent paper by Kwa?niewicz and Czarnecki (Appl Spectrosc 2018, 72: 288). Near-infrared spectra of 1-alcohols from methanol to 1-decanol in the pure liquid phase were recorded from 5200 to 9000?cm?1. The similarities and differences between the spectra were analyzed by the classical and chemometric methods (principal component analysis). The obtained results reveal that the near-infrared spectra of methanol, ethanol, and 1-propanol are appreciably different from the spectra of higher 1-alcohols. As shown, the degree of self-association of 1-alcohols decreases with the increase in the chain length
